How to prepare for a job interview at Private Equity Insights IVS
✨Know Your Investors
Before the interview, research the firm’s current and past investors. Understand their investment strategies and what they value in a partnership. This will help you tailor your responses and show that you’re genuinely interested in building those relationships.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
As this role requires strong communication skills, prepare to demonstrate your ability to convey complex information clearly. Practice articulating your thoughts on investor relations and be ready to discuss how you’ve successfully engaged with stakeholders in the past.
✨Be Proactive in Your Approach
Highlight instances where you took the initiative in previous roles. Whether it was leading a project or identifying new opportunities for engagement, showing your proactive nature will resonate well with the entrepreneurial spirit of the team.
✨Prepare for Global Conference Scenarios
Since participation in global conferences is part of the role, think about your experiences at such events. Be ready to discuss how you’ve networked, presented, or contributed to discussions, as this will illustrate your capability to represent the firm effectively.
